The bouzouki is of Greek origin, but was "adopted" by Irish musicians on the 60's. The round-backed Greek model was changed to a flat back, and 2 extra strings were added to give the typical Irish bouzouki.
The most common tunings for accompaniment are GDAd and ADAd; GDAe is sometimes used.
The bouzouki is particularly suited to the accompaniment of Irish music because of its open sound, and it the possibility of playing modal chords and a mixture of harmonic and melodic accompaniment, to enhance all the nuances of the music.
Recommended listening : Planxty, Nomos, Alec Finn (De Danaan)
